VALVE DISASSEMBLY

Refer to Figure 8-1, or Figure 8-2 and proceed as follows:

CM15. Close the upstream and downstream shutoff valves before and after the Control Valve. If it is

necessary to keep the Heater in operation, proceed in accordance with step OP3 in the
OPERATING Section of this manual before continuing. If not, proceed directly to the next step.

CM16. If the Control Valve is easily accessible for disassembly and reassembly, leave it installed in the

fluid line. If it is not easily accessible, remove the Valve from the line and clamp it in a bench vise
for easy accessibility.

CM17. Completely remove the Actuator (27) and Linkage Assembly (26) from the Valve Body as

described in steps CM1 through CM5.

CM18. Refer to Figure 8-1 or Figure 8-2. It is strongly recommended that disassembly of the Valve be

limited to only the steps necessary to restore the Valve to proper operation. However, the
following steps cover complete disassembly, if necessary. When performing Valve disassembly,
USE EXTREME CARE not to mar or scratch any surfaces. The following steps assume that the
Actuator and Linkage Assemblies have already been removed from the Valve Body.

CM19. Remove the following parts in the order specified:

CAUTION

CAREFULLY remove the Packing Nut (18) and Cap Screws (14) indicated below
to relieve any trapped pressure.

• Hex Nuts (17)
• Packing Nut (18)
• Packing Assembly (20)
• Cap

Screws

(14)

• Valve Top (21)
• Valve Top Gasket (13)
